本文目录导读:
随着互联网技术的飞速发展,大数据、云计算等新兴领域逐渐成为主流,分布式对象存储作为新一代存储技术,凭借其高性能、高可靠性和易扩展性等特点,成为众多企业和机构的首选,本文将深入探讨分布式对象存储技术,分析其架构、优势以及在实际应用中的表现。
分布式对象存储技术概述
分布式对象存储技术是一种基于对象存储架构的分布式存储系统,它将存储空间划分为多个存储节点,通过数据分片、复制和负载均衡等技术,实现海量数据的存储和访问,与传统的关系型数据库相比,分布式对象存储技术具有更高的数据吞吐量和更强的横向扩展能力。
图片来源于网络,如有侵权联系删除
分布式对象存储技术架构
1、数据分片
数据分片是分布式对象存储技术的基础,它将数据按照一定的规则划分成多个小片段,存储在不同的存储节点上,数据分片可以按照数据ID、时间戳、地理位置等维度进行划分,从而提高数据检索效率。
2、数据复制
为了提高数据可靠性和访问速度,分布式对象存储技术通常采用数据复制机制,数据复制可以将数据副本存储在多个存储节点上,实现数据的冗余存储,当某个存储节点发生故障时,其他节点可以接管其工作,保证系统的高可用性。
3、负载均衡
负载均衡技术可以平衡各个存储节点的负载,避免单个节点过载,提高系统整体性能,分布式对象存储技术通常采用轮询、最小连接数、最少请求等方法实现负载均衡。
4、元数据管理
元数据管理是分布式对象存储技术的核心组成部分,它负责存储和管理对象的元数据信息,如对象ID、对象大小、存储节点地址等,元数据管理可以实现对象的快速检索和高效访问。
图片来源于网络,如有侵权联系删除
分布式对象存储技术优势
1、高性能
分布式对象存储技术采用多节点协同工作,可以实现海量数据的并行访问,从而提高数据吞吐量和响应速度。
2、高可靠性
数据复制和冗余存储机制使得分布式对象存储技术具有很高的数据可靠性,即使部分存储节点发生故障,系统仍然可以正常运行。
3、易扩展性
分布式对象存储技术采用横向扩展的方式,可以轻松应对数据量的增长,当存储需求增加时,只需增加存储节点即可。
4、良好的兼容性
分布式对象存储技术支持多种访问协议,如HTTP、RESTful API等,方便与其他系统进行集成。
图片来源于网络,如有侵权联系删除
分布式对象存储技术应用
1、大数据存储
分布式对象存储技术可以应用于大数据场景,如日志存储、视频存储等,通过分布式存储架构,可以满足海量数据的存储需求。
2、云计算平台
分布式对象存储技术可以作为云计算平台的基础设施,为云服务提供数据存储和访问支持。
3、物联网
在物联网领域,分布式对象存储技术可以用于存储大量传感器数据,实现设备的远程监控和管理。
分布式对象存储技术作为一种新兴的存储技术,具有高性能、高可靠性和易扩展性等优势,随着技术的不断发展,分布式对象存储技术将在更多领域得到应用,为我国互联网产业的发展贡献力量。
标签: #分布式对象存储
评论列表